Abstract
A tubing string, such as a coiled tubing or jointed tubing string, has an agitator mounted within an interior of the tubing string at an intermediate position between an uphole end and a downhole end of the tubing string. A tubing agitator is structured to be installed within a tubing string. A method includes: forming or installing a seat within an interior of a tubing string at an intermediate position between an uphole end and a downhole end of the tubing string; and conveying an agitator through the interior of the tubing string until the agitator contacts the seat. A hammer drift tool is also described.
